: The term "Ladli" was popularized by Goswami Shri Narayan Bhatt , who discovered the deity of Radha Rani 450 years ago and treated her with the affection one has for a beloved daughter.
: "Ladli adbhut nazara, tere Barsane mein hai..." (O Beloved, there is a wonderful sight in your Barsana...)
The bhajan (लाड़ली अद्भुत नजारा) is a soulful expression of devotion (Bhakti) centered on the divine and mesmerizing beauty of Barsana , the birthplace of Shri Radha Rani (affectionately called "Ladli Ji").
: It serves as a prayer for a single glance of mercy ( Kripa ) from the Queen of Braj.
The lyrics tell a story of a devotee’s arrival in Barsana, where they are overwhelmed by a "wonderful sight" ( adbhut nazara ). In this sacred landscape, the devotee experiences:
